Orff: Carmina Burana Gundula Janowitz, Gerhard Stolze, Dietrich Fischer-Dieskau, Chorus and Orchestra of the Deutsche Oper Berlin conducted by Eugen Jochum Sung by world renowned soloists and conducted by the legendary Eugen Jochum, this recording of Carl Orff's Carmina Burana was authorised by the composer himself. It follows, therefore, that the present recording met with the high requirements of the composer himself and so represents an unusual collector's item. Orff intended not just to copy the medieval lyrics but to express the mood of that era. His highly rhythmic compositional style reflects the archaic character of the vocal line. The listener experiences not only the vital primordial pulse of the music in this thrilling interpretation but also the mystery of Fate through the tender lyrical passages. Orff's homage to wine, women and song of the Middle Ages, closely bound up with spring and love, is supported by balanced and precise sound technology. The listener is spirited away to the musical world of Carmina Burana by this recording. Recording: October 1967 at the Ufa Studio, Berlin by Klaus Scheibe / Production: Dr. Hans Hirsch2. Beethoven Bicentennial Collection - Music for the Stage - Vol. V 5 LPs in box with booklet. This box contains Beethoven's stage music as follows: Fidelio (opera), performed by Dresden State Orchestra and Opera Chorus, and the Leipzig Radio Choir, conducted by Karl Bohm, with soloists Martti Talvela (Don Fernando); Theo Adam (Don Pizarro); James King (Florestan); Gwyneth Jones (Leonore); Franz Crass (Rocco); Edith Mathis (Marzelline); Peter Schreier (Jaquino). The Ruins of Athens, Op. 113 (complete incidental music), with the Berlin Philharmonic Orchestra and the RIAS Chamber Choir conducted by Bernhard Klee and these soloists: Arleen Auger, Klaus Hirte, and Franz Crass. The Creatures of Prometheus, Op. 43 (excerpts from the ballet), performed by the Berlin Philharmonic Orchestra conducted by Bernhard Klee. An die ferne Geliebte (song cycle) Op. 98 and Gellert Leider (songs), Op. 48, performed by Dietrich Fischer-Dieskau and Jorg Demus. Incidental music to Egmont, Op. 84, performed by Berlin Philharmonic Orchestra conducted by Herbert von Karajan, with soloists Gundula Janowitz and Erich Schellow.4.
